Biography
Martin Fourcade is a French biathlete. Two-time winner of the 2014 Olympics, winner of 3 gold medals at the 2018 Olympic Games, 11-time world champion, the first 7-time World Cup winner in biathlon history and author of many absolute records in this sport.

Childhood and youth
Martin Fourcade was born in the fall of 1988 in the French district of Céret. The athlete's dark skin has repeatedly raised questions about nationality, until the results of a study of the family tree of the family appeared on the Internet. The biathlete's ancestors are French for dozens of generations. Among them are mayors of settlements, alpine arrows, winemakers.
As is often the case with professional athletes, the future Olympic champion grew up in a family where the sport was appreciated and respected. Parents of Martin and his brother Simon went in for cross-country skiing at an amateur level. Despite this, the first sports section of Simon and Martin was the hockey one.
And who knows, perhaps the great biathlete would never have appeared, if not for the distance from the ice hall to the house of the Fourcade family. In an interview, the athlete's father jokingly said that he simply did not have time to take the children to training, so he first sent the older, and then the younger, to the ski section.
Simon quickly got bored of skiing, and he switched to biathlon. In an effort to keep up with his older brother, he took a sporting rifle in his hands and Martin. So a series of accidents caused the appearance in professional sports of Martin Fourcade, the world biathlon star. Although the biathlete himself did not hide that the sporting successes of the family influenced his career.
The sports biography of Martin Fourcade began in 2002, and already in 2006 the guy became a member of the French biathlon team. In 2007, the junior world championship presented Martin with a bronze medal, although subsequently Fourcade did not soon have to climb the podium.

Biathlon
The ascent of one great French biathlete to the sports Olympus coincided with the end of the career of another famous representative of France - Raphael Poiret. Martin did not call Raphael his idol and has already surpassed the achievements of the famous compatriot, demonstrating the continuity of generations in French biathlon.
In 2017, Poiret said that Fourcade has reached a maximum and in the near future, the results will decline. But if the athlete continues to compete, then only with himself. And to become famous, in addition to victories, you need to create a story and a distinctive image. In this, Martin succeeded, legends are made about his megalomania and posturing.
According to Rafael, the successor has achieved wild popularity thanks to Instagram and Facebook, while his generation has not heard of social networks.
In the first World Cup, Martin took part in 2008 (stage in Oslo), in the same year he ended his career and Poiret. By the way, the first race was extremely unsuccessful for the future champion - Fourcade came to the finish line in the top seven. In the future, getting into the top 30 became an unattainable goal for him, and many considered the silver in the mass start at the Vancouver 2010 Olympics to be a sensation.
However, there is a saying that biathlon does not tolerate fuss, and the sport itself is called "age". Sochi Olympic champion Ole Einar Bjoerndalen is proof of this. With these factors in mind, Fourcade was planning a long career.
In the 2010-2011 season, they started talking seriously about the new star of the French national team. This was facilitated by the final 3rd place according to the results of the World Cup, several "golden pedestals", one of which was won in the crown style of Bjoerndalen. Even having missed 3 times, Fourcade managed to bypass competitors on the track. Even then, they began to compare the biathlete, albeit cautiously, with the great Norwegian. In 2012, Fourcade won the overall World Cup and won 2 Small Crystal Globes in sprints and pursuit races.
3 gold medals and a silver medal at the World Championship finally secured the status of a biathlon superstar for the Frenchman. In 2013, Fourcade demonstrated remarkable stability, receiving the "Large Crystal Globe" and another "Small Crystal Globe". In addition, the athlete significantly improved his shooting, gained additional experience. Therefore, even before the start of the Olympic Games in Sochi, Fourcade was announced in advance as the main favorite of the tournament.
The Sochi Olympics became the finest hour of the Frenchman, Martin won the pursuit (12.5 km) and the individual race (20 km). After this competition, Fourcade was rightfully named the new king of biathlon, second only to the Emperor in skill (nickname of Ole Einar Bjoerndalen).
From 3 to 13 March 2016, the first stage of the Biathlon World Championship took place in Holmenkollen, Norway. Fourcade helped the French national team win gold in the mixed relay. The second stage in Pokljuka (Slovenia) brought the biathlete 3 gold medals, and at the tournament held on the ski track in the town of Nove Mesto (Czech Republic), the Frenchman also showed good results, winning 1st place in the overall standings of the World Cup.
2016, as the athlete himself stated, was the most successful in his career. The biathlete managed to get hold of the entire collection of globes, which already happened in 2013.
In March 2017, Martin won the sprint race at the Biathlon World Cup, which took place in Kontiolahti, Finland. Thus, the Frenchman broke the record for the number of victories in one season for the Norwegian Ole Einar Bjoerndalen, setting a record for the number of triumphs at the World Cup stages.
As the fans of the athlete noticed, Martin easily part with the awards of this tournament and keeps only the medals of the Olympics and world championships. After the sprint in Khanty-Mansiysk in March 2015, the biathlete presented a medal of the highest standard to schoolgirl Dasha. After 2 years, he parted with the golden "pancake" won at home in Annecy, in the mass start.
In 2018, little Veronica was lucky in Finland. As the girl's father later recalled, before the start of the race, the daughter whispered that maybe this time the Frenchman would not forget about the tradition. And when it happened, I couldn’t believe my eyes. The family later thanked the athlete on Facebook.
Having won in Finland, Fourcade in an interview with the media said that he plans to end his professional career in 2018.
The biathlete made a similar statement after participating in the World Cup, which was held in the Norwegian Holmenkollen. It should be noted that Martin's next performance was not without scandals. The Frenchman was accused of breaking the rules. In Norway, Fourcade came to the first firing line, starting to prepare for shooting, but realized that his clips were empty. The coach provided the athlete with ammunition, which is prohibited by the rules. In the end, the Frenchman won the race.
In this case, the French biathlete escaped disqualification. Representatives of the International Biathlon Union (IBU) reacted to the incident, stating that Fourcade did not violate the rules, as he acted according to the situation.
However, other participants in the competition called the incident a bias on the part of an international organization that does not notice the actions of individual biathletes.
Many recalled the behavior of Martin Fourcade at the World Championships in Hochfilzen, Austria. In February 2017, the Frenchman cut off the Russian biathlete Alexander Loginov when changing the stage. Fourcade's maneuvers caused the Russian to fall on the ski track. This moment was clearly recorded on video.
Before the awards ceremony, Russian biathletes refused to shake hands with Fourcade, which is why the Frenchman defiantly left the podium. Users of Instagram and other social networks then violently reacted to Fourcade's actions, condemning him for such behavior. Many biathlon fans and enthusiasts said they had lost all respect for the Frenchman.
Russian biathlete Anton Shipulin, who participated in the race, noted at a press conference that such an attitude of Martin Fourcade to Alexander Loginov is a negative perception of the entire team from the Russian Federation.

Personal life
The personal life of Martin Fourcade is always in the spotlight of the press. More than once in the media it was reported about the numerous novels of the Frenchman, as well as about the engagement with one of the famous biathletes. Martin himself once jokingly admitted that Marie Dorin-Habert, a mixed relay partner, was "like a wife to him." This was the reason for the rumors about the relationship between the athletes.

It is known that for many years the life of Martin Fourcade is associated with the French teacher Helene Usabiega. The couple met in their teens at a competition - the girl also went skiing. Then they talked at a distance, met when the athlete turned 17, but then Helen left to study. However, young people never "interrupted that which tied together."
The common-law wife of Martin Fourcade on September 10, 2015 gave him a daughter, Manon. In March 2017, the second daughter Ines was born. Helen supports her chosen one, helps in competitions.
The biathlete calls the pursuit of sports at a professional level a kind of reason for self-development, and considers an enhanced training program to be useful self-torture. Oddly enough, among the idols of Martin Fourcade there is not a single biathlete, but the Moroccan runner Hisham el-Guerrouge and the swimmer from the USA Michael Phelps are examples of performance for the Frenchman.
Perhaps, Martin has reserved the place of the greatest biathlete for himself. It is known that Fourcade is one of the most famous skiers and biathletes who do not take drugs "strictly prescribed by a doctor", which in a sense are permitted doping.
Recall that in Vancouver, at the classic distance of 30 kilometers, the top five consisted entirely of athletes who needed medication, and many people associate Bjoerndalen's longevity on the track with ephedrine, a drug that is allowed in acceptable doses. Martin Fourcade has repeatedly stated that he is a supporter of "pure" struggle.

Martin Fourcade now
For those who are looking for an answer to the question of how to become the king of biathlon, Martin at the end of 2017 released the book "My Dream of Gold and Snow". In addition to sports secrets, readers have learned from the pages of knowledge about how to make money on victories. Fourcade put on a commercial track relations with the media, communication with sponsors. When the first medals went, the biathlete already knew what language to speak with brand representatives. Now the management of financial flows is entrusted to the company bearing the name of the champion.
A tall handsome man with relief muscles (Martin's height is 185 cm, weight - 75 kg) is a tasty object for advertisers. However, the Frenchman is more important not the fee, but the image and form of cooperation. Fourcade has said more than once that he will not undertake to advertise what he does not like. Therefore, he does not have an agent, but only a lawyer who will not embarrass the client by being tempted by money.
At the Olympics in Pyeongchang, Martin carried the flag of the French national team. In the fight for medals, the biathlete had to worry. The main rival of Fourcade that season was the Norwegian Johannes Boe. In face-to-face battles on the track, the athlete won 3 gold, and in the mass start, the owner of the medal was determined only by the results of the photo finish.
At the World Cup that lasted after the Games, Fourcade was hampered by an intestinal infection and a broken stick. And yet he set a biathlon record: in 22 races in 2017-2018, in which the athlete participated, each ended with a prize on the podium.
The beginning of the new season for Martin was spoiled by the decision of the French government to levy a tax on the prize money earned by athletes at the Olympics in South Korea. The prize for French athletes was € 50,000 for gold, € 20,000 for silver and € 13,000 for bronze.

Awards and achievements
Commander of the Order of Merit Commander of the Order of the Legion of Honor
Olympic victories:
2014 - Sochi (Russia), 12.5 km pursuit, 2014 - Sochi (Russia), individual 20 km 2018 - Pyeongchang, 15 km mass start 2018 - Pyeongchang, mixed relay 2018 - Pyeongchang, 12.5 km pursuit
World Championship and World Cup victories
2011 - Khanty-Mansiysk (Russia), 12.5 km pursuit 2012 - Ruhpolding (Germany), 10 km sprint 2012 - Ruhpolding (Germany), 12.5 km pursuit 2012 - Ruhpolding (Germany), 15 km mass start 2013 - Nove Mesto (Czech Republic), individual 20 km 2015 - Kontiolahti (Finland), individual 20 km 2016 - Holmenkollen (Norway), mixed relay 2016 - Holmenkollen (Norway), 10 km sprint 2016 - Holmenkollen (Norway), 12.5 km pursuit 2016 - Holmenkollen (Norway), individual 20 km 2017 - Hochfilzen (Austria), 12.5 km pursuit 2018 - Holmenkollen (Norway), 12.5 km pursuit 2018 - Tyumen, 10 km sprint 2018 - Tyumen, 12.5 km pursuit
